Cleveland Discovery: Live Online Auction

Cowan's Cleveland Discovery: Live Online Auction will feature an eclectic variety of fine and decorative art including paintings, prints, porcelain, glass, silver, books, and more. There is no in-person bidding for this auction. Live bidding will occur online or over the phone.
